Career statistics for John Stockton (1985-2003) and Magic Johnson (1980-1996) side by side, with an interactive chart to compare any stat by age across regular season and playoffs.
| Career | John Stockton | Magic Johnson |
|---|---|---|
| Games Played | 1,504 | 906 |
| Career Points | 19,711 | 17,707 |
| Points Per Game | 13.1 | 19.5 |
| Rebounds Per Game | 2.7 | 7.2 |
| Assists Per Game | 10.5 | 11.2 |
| Field Goal % | 51.5% | 52.0% |
| 3-Point % | 38.4% | 30.4% |
| True Shooting % | 60.8% | 61.0% |
John Stockton scored more career points, 19,711 to 17,707, in the NBA regular season.
Magic Johnson averaged more points per game for his career, 19.5 PPG to 13.1 PPG.
Magic Johnson averaged more rebounds per game, 7.2 RPG to 2.7 RPG.
Magic Johnson averaged more assists per game, 11.2 APG to 10.5 APG.
John Stockton shot better from three for his career, 38.4% to 30.4%.
Magic Johnson posted the higher career true shooting percentage, 61.0% to 60.8%.
